I purchased a DPR-1260 print server back in March '09 and up until a month ago had my HP Laserjet 2100 printer working perfectly. I tried to print to it a month back and noticed that I wasn't getting any jobs through, so I tried to reset the print server manually using the button on the back. At first, the print server would not even reset itself. I left the print server completely unplugged from power and devices for a couple days. When I went back to it after this time, I could now reset the device and established the wireless setup and connection between the router and print server again.
However, upon trying to go through the printer setup, I received the message "Printer Device ID Error" when trying to setup the HP again. I tried connecting the USB to each of the ports, wondering if I had a port that went bad, but all 4 ports reported the same thing. I went out and purchased a new parallel to usb cable thinking that maybe the one I had been using went bad, but that proved not to be the case. I had been running firmware 1.21, but updated to 1.24 to see if that changed anything.
I even went so far as to look at my printer port settings and try to create a port setting for the print server manually, on the off chance I could send the print jobs to the device without having to go through the online setup (which I thought just created a file to do that very thing for the user.)
At this point I think my print server went bad. I'm wondering if anyone out there has any other troubleshooting ideas as to what I can do.
